Complete Tempo Chart for Classical and Modern Music
A comprehensive tempo chart bridges the gap between classical Italian terminology and modern digital production. Specifically, it translates historical musical directions into exact, usable beats per minute. Film composers and orchestrators can quickly verify their desired emotional pacing.
Understanding these traditional markings enhances your communication with classically trained musicians. Terms like “Allegro” or “Adagio” carry specific emotional connotations beyond just speed. Our complete tempo chart includes both the numerical values and their expressive meanings.
Moreover, this reference is invaluable when sampling classical recordings or scoring for visual media. Mastering these tempo conventions adds sophistication and professionalism to your compositions.
| Italian Term | English Meaning | BPM Range | Character/Mood |
|---|---|---|---|
| Larghissimo | Extremely Slow | < 24 | Very Broad, Solemn |
| Grave | Slow and Solemn | 25-45 | Serious, Weighty |
| Largo | Broadly | 40-60 | Dignified, Wide |
| Lento | Slowly | 45-60 | Leisurely, Calm |
| Adagio | Slowly, at Ease | 66-76 | Peaceful, Restful |
| Andante | Walking Pace | 76-108 | Flowing, Moderate |
| Moderato | Moderately | 108-120 | Balanced, Steady |
| Allegro | Fast, Quick | 120-156 | Bright, Cheerful |
| Vivace | Lively | 156-176 | Energetic, Vivid |
| Presto | Very Fast | 168-200 | Rapid, Swift |
| Prestissimo | Extremely Fast | > 200 | As Fast as Possible |

How Music Producers Use BPM in Real Projects
While BPM is often explained as a simple measurement of beats per minute, experienced producers know that tempo directly influences a song’s energy, groove, and emotional impact. Therefore, choosing the right BPM is one of the first decisions made during music production.
Different music genres tend to use specific BPM ranges because listeners associate certain tempos with particular feelings and styles. As a result, understanding these common ranges helps producers create tracks that fit audience expectations while maintaining creative flexibility.
House Music (124–128 BPM)
House music typically falls between 124 and 128 BPM because this range creates a steady and danceable groove. The tempo is fast enough to keep energy high on the dance floor while remaining comfortable for long DJ sets.
Many producers choose 126 BPM as a starting point because it provides a balanced tempo for drums, basslines, and rhythmic effects. Delay and reverb effects often sync naturally within this BPM range, making it easier to create professional-sounding mixes.
Tech House (126–130 BPM)
Tech House generally uses slightly faster tempos ranging from 126 to 130 BPM. Tracks feel more energetic and driving than traditional house music. Faster pace helps create momentum during club performances and festival sets.
Producers frequently use BPM conversion tools and delay time calculators when designing Tech House tracks because synchronized effects play a major role in the genre’s signature sound.
Hip-Hop (80–100 BPM)
Hip-hop producers commonly work between 80 and 100 BPM because this range allows space for vocal delivery, storytelling, and rhythmic variation. Slower tempos create room for heavy drum patterns and deep bass elements.
However, many modern hip-hop tracks use double-time rhythms, which can make a 75 BPM beat feel similar in energy to a 150 BPM track. Therefore, understanding tempo relationships is essential when creating contemporary hip-hop productions.
Trap Music (130–150 BPM)
Trap music usually falls between 130 and 150 BPM because faster tempos support rapid hi-hat rolls, energetic drum programming, and powerful bass drops. Producers often use 140 BPM as a standard starting point for trap beats.
Although trap tracks may seem extremely fast, many producers think of them in half-time. For example, a 140 BPM trap beat often feels like 70 BPM from a rhythmic perspective. Consequently, producers gain flexibility when arranging melodies and percussion.
Pop Music (90–130 BPM)
Pop music covers a broad BPM range because different songs aim to create different emotional responses. For example, emotional ballads may use tempos around 70 to 90 BPM, while upbeat radio hits often fall between 110 and 130 BPM.
Pop producers frequently experiment with multiple BPM values before finalizing a song. Tempo adjustments of just a few BPM can significantly change how listeners perceive energy and movement.
EDM and Festival Music (128–150 BPM)
Electronic Dance Music relies heavily on tempo because BPM determines how crowds experience rhythm and energy. Many EDM producers build entire tracks around carefully selected BPM values.
For instance, progressive house often centers around 128 BPM, while big-room and festival tracks may range from 128 to 135 BPM. Producers use BPM-to-milliseconds calculations to synchronize delay effects, risers, and transitions throughout a project.
Drum and Bass (170–175 BPM)
Drum and Bass producers commonly use tempos between 170 and 175 BPM because the genre depends on fast breakbeats and high-energy rhythms. Despite the fast BPM, skilled producers create grooves that remain controlled and musical.
Effects timing becomes increasingly important at higher tempos. Many Drum and Bass producers rely on BPM calculators, note length calculators, and delay time tools to maintain precise rhythmic synchronization.
Why Producers Use BPM Tools
In real-world production sessions, tempo affects much more than song speed. For example, BPM influences note length calculations, delay timing, metronome settings, beat matching, and MIDI sequencing. Consequently, professional producers frequently use BPM calculators, BPM-to-milliseconds converters, metronomes, and delay calculators throughout the production process.
Whether you are creating a house track at 126 BPM, a trap beat at 140 BPM, or a Drum and Bass track at 174 BPM, selecting the right tempo helps establish the foundation for the entire song. Understanding BPM is not only a technical skill but also an important creative decision.
